Job Description
Overview

The Governors of Shrewsbury Cathedral Catholic Primary School and Nursery, together with the Diocese of Shrewsbury and Our Lady Help of Christians Catholic Academy Trust, are seeking to appoint an exceptional, faith-filled and ambitious Catholic leader to become our next Headteacher.

Situated in the heart of Shrewsbury and serving a wonderfully diverse community, our school is proud to be a place where every child is known, valued and loved. We are a warm, inclusive Catholic school where strong relationships, high aspirations and Gospel values shape everything we do.

Our school is built upon a strong ethos of caring, sharing and service. We work closely with families, the parish and wider community to ensure that every child flourishes academically, spiritually, socially and emotionally. We are proud of our commitment to Catholic Social Teaching, charitable outreach and the development of caring, responsible young people who live their faith through action.

The Governors are looking for an inspirational Headteacher who will build upon our many strengths, nurture our distinctive Catholic character and lead our community confidently into the next stage of its journey.

Governing Board Criteria

The Governing Board are looking for a committed and practising Catholic who:

  • As a practising Catholic, demonstrates a strong faith and commitment to the Catholic ethos of the school and its community.
  • Can articulate and lead a compelling vision rooted in Gospel values.
  • Is passionate about ensuring every child is known, valued and enabled to achieve their full God-given potential.
  • Has a proven track record of successful leadership and school improvement.
  • Understands the importance of strong partnerships between school, home, parish and community.
  • Is committed to inclusion and values the uniqueness of every child and family.
  • Promotes excellence in teaching, learning and personal development.
  • Has the strategic leadership skills necessary to lead staff, resources and finances effectively.
  • Can inspire and develop others through coaching, empowerment and high expectations.
  • Will actively contribute to the leadership and collaboration opportunities within Our Lady Help of Christians Catholic Academy Trust.
